The Old School Way to Organize Pro Cricket Tournaments

To really understand this new way of running a tournament we need to look back at the way things have been done in the past.

When you are running a ten-team league, you have to create a fixture list (schedule of matches) where every team plays every other team. You have to ensure no team has excessive travel requirements from one match venue to another; you cannot double book venue(s) on the same day or time. There are hundreds of players, coaches and support staff with contracts that need to be managed, and each of those contracts needs to ensure everyone is paid according to their individual match payment and retainer agreement; on time, and at the rate they had contracted for.

Then, of course, there is all the different types of hospitality associated with an event, as well as the logistics associated with getting everyone to/from their flight connections; arranging transport from the airport to the hotel as well as coordinating from the hotel to the stadium. Organizing catering, security, ticketing and broadcasting logistics occurs in a similar manner. If one flight is delayed, it creates a chain reaction that can disrupt practice times for the teams involved, the press conferences and, sometimes, even the match itself.

In order to accomplish a successful tournament under this historical management practice will require massive spreadsheets, numerous email correspondence back and forth, and numerous tournament managers that are putting out "fires" each day. This method is extremely susceptible to human error, extremely inefficient and extremely costly.

Emergent and Diligence AI Enter the Scene

The rules have changed; an Indian company is taking AI and putting it into the cricket administration’s mainframe.

The MPCA has entered into a formal partnership with Emergent and Diligence AI for automated processing of the entire backend functions we discussed earlier. We're not just talking about using AI to look at how a player's swing or predicting game outcomes. We're talking about using AI to run the day-to-day operations of the tournament.

The first tournament of this type will be the upcoming Madhya Pradesh League (MPL). The MPL will continue to grow; there are new franchises for the MPL; and provide more young cricketers with an opportunity to advance to the major leagues. With growth in the number of teams, there will be even greater logistical challenges for the MPCA. Instead of simply expanding their human workforce, the MPCA is looking to smart technology for its solution.

Understanding What ”Automating the Backend” Means

Now that you have a clearer picture, how does this work in real life? When Emergent and Diligence AI support the backends of tournaments such as the MPL, the AI acts as the ultimate general manager.

Below is an example of what a fully automated cricket tournament would look like:

Dynamic Scheduling: Rather than spending weeks preparing schedules the old-fashioned way, AI will produce the best possible schedule for an entire tournament in mere seconds. The system will use AI algorithms to generate and check if a tournament contains travel, fatigue, stadium availability, and broadcast window variables as well as use historical weather (at 3-month historical average, for example) to optimize the season for a given tournament. If there is a rain out, the AI will recalculate the entire schedule on its own and propose the best alternative dates to hold any affected matches.

Logistics & Travel: The AI will automatically sync with airline/hotel systems and will provide the best travel routes/rates for teams. If a match goes long, the AI will automatically delay the departure time of the bus and will inform the hotel staff to keep their kitchens open late for the players.

Contracts and Roster Management: The complexity of a player’s contract can be overwhelming due to various components such as base salary, bonus for performance, and injury protection. The use of an automated solution allows you to track the involvement and performance of players for payroll, and payment distribution. An automated method provides flawless and timely payroll without the need for daily manual accounting.

Resource Allocation: AI can accurately predict the amount of security personnel needed to accommodate anticipated ticket sales and the amount of catering needed for the event. By utilizing AI to manage physical resources, you reduce the amount of waste which ultimately saves you money.
